psutil
是一个用于获取系统信息的 Python 库,它本身是安全的,但在使用过程中仍需注意以下几点以确保安全性:
-
只在可信环境中使用:确保你的代码只在受信任的环境中运行,避免在公共网络或不受信任的计算机上使用。
-
验证输入:在使用
psutil
时,确保对用户输入进行验证和清理。避免使用不可信的数据调用psutil
函数,以防止潜在的安全风险。 -
限制权限:尽量以最小权限原则运行你的应用程序。例如,如果你的应用程序只需要获取某些系统信息,不要请求不需要的权限。
-
更新
psutil
:定期更新psutil
库以修复已知的安全漏洞。 -
避免敏感操作:不要使用
psutil
执行敏感操作,如修改系统设置、访问用户数据等。 -
使用安全连接:在需要与远程服务器通信时,使用安全的连接方式,如 HTTPS。
-
错误处理:确保你的代码能够妥善处理异常和错误,避免泄露敏感信息。
总之,虽然 psutil
本身是安全的,但在使用过程中仍需注意安全性。遵循最佳实践和建议,可以确保你的应用程序在使用 psutil
时保持安全和可靠。